Marozzo Cup 2023

by


The Marozzo Cup is an epic test of Historical Martial Arts prowess.

Three core tournaments are included in the battle for the Cup itself: Longsword, Sword & Buckler, & Sidesword. These tournaments will be run concurrently, swapping weapons and fencing with the same opponent.

In addition there are stand alone tournaments in: Rapier & Dagger, Spear, and Beginner/Restricted Longsword.

How will the three core tournaments work?
Progression to eliminations in the Longsword, Sword & Buckler, and Sidesword tournaments will be based on your performance across all three weapons.
Each match will be fought as up to three sub matches, first Longsword, then Sword & Buckler, then Sidesword.

Can I compete in just one or two of Longsword, Sword & Buckler, and Singlesword?
Yes. You can compete in just one or two. However, with only two weapons it will be harder to progress to eliminations, and with just one weapon progressing to elims will be extremely difficult.

Will the results be submitted to HEMA Ratings?
Yes. Individual matches from all the tournaments except for Restricted Longsword will be submitted to HEMA Ratings.

Who can compete in the Restricted Longsword Tournament?
Anyone who hasn’t competed in a longsword tournament before, or anyone who is still in their first 12 months of HEMA.

Will there be swords to borrow?
Yes there will be loaner Longswords, Sideswords, Bucklers, Rapiers, Daggers, and Spears to borrow if needed. There will also be some limited loaner PPE – with priority going to newer fencers. If you need to borrow something we encourage you to organise it with your home club in advance.
